How Do I Prepare for the CSE

The Civil Services Examination (CSE) is considered to be the mother of all written examinations. It is a curriculum heavy examination especially at the Main exam stage. A candidate, therefore, has to prepare first for the Main Exam and then for the Prelim. This is so because, if one starts his preparation for the Main exam after the having written the Prelim exam, he will have just four months (June to September) to prepare two optional subjects, essay and General Studies, which is almost impossible to achieve. Each optional subject is of post graduation level and at least one of them will be totally a new subject. In majority of the cases, candidates land up with two new optional subjects.
